The Story Behind Dum Laga Ke Haisha

Dum Laga Ke Haisha translates to "Carry Her with Pride," and this simple yet profound title captures the essence of this delightful romantic comedy. Set in the 1990s in Haridwar, India, the film tells the story of Prem Prakash Tiwari (played by Ayushmann Khurrana), a high school dropout who runs his family's cassette shop, and Sandhya Verma (played by Bhumi Pednekar), an educated and confident woman who happens to be overweight.

The film begins with a traditional arranged marriage between Prem and Sandhya. Prem, still living in his teenage years, is initially repulsed by the idea of marrying someone he considers "too fat." Sandhya, despite her education and confidence, faces constant criticism about her weight from society and her new family. Their relationship starts on a rocky note, with Prem unable to accept his wife and Sandhya struggling to find her place in a family that seems to mock her appearance.

Character Analysis and Cast Details

The Main Cast

ActorCharacterRole Description
Ayushmann KhurranaPrem Prakash TiwariA directionless young man running his family's cassette shop, struggling with his own insecurities
Bhumi PednekarSandhya VermaAn educated, confident woman who faces weight-based discrimination but maintains her dignity
Sanjay MishraShri Prakash TiwariPrem's father, a traditional man trying to run his business
Alka AminSumitra TiwariPrem's mother, who supports traditional values but also shows compassion

The chemistry between Ayushmann Khurrana and Bhumi Pednekar is the heart of the film. Khurrana's portrayal of a confused, immature young man perfectly complements Pednekar's confident yet vulnerable performance. What makes their performances remarkable is how they handle sensitive topics with humor and grace.

But Dum Laga Ke Haisha isn't just about a mismatched couple - it's a story of personal growth and societal change. The film brilliantly portrays how both Prem and Sandhya evolve throughout their journey. Prem learns to look beyond physical appearances and discovers the depth of Sandhya's character - her kindness, intelligence, and unwavering spirit. Sandhya learns to stand up for herself and realize her own worth beyond what society dictates.

The turning point comes when they participate in a local competition where husbands must carry their wives through an obstacle course. This "Dum Laga Ke Haisha" race becomes a metaphor for their relationship - Prem must literally carry Sandhya, but in doing so, he also carries the weight of his prejudices and learns to accept her completely.

The Cultural Context and Social Commentary

Dum Laga Ke Haisha provides a window into middle-class Indian life in the 1990s, complete with cassette shops, small-town values, and traditional family dynamics.

The film doesn't shy away from addressing serious social issues. It tackles body shaming, the pressure on women to conform to beauty standards, and the superficiality of judging people based on appearance. Through humor and sensitivity, it shows how these prejudices affect real people's lives and relationships. Sandhya's character represents countless women who face discrimination based on their weight, while Prem's journey represents society's need to evolve beyond superficial judgments.

The film's strength lies in its realistic portrayal of relationships. Unlike typical Bollywood romances that rely on grand gestures and perfect couples, this film shows love in its most imperfect, messy form.

The music, composed by Anu Malik, adds another layer of charm to the film. Songs like "Dard Karaara" and "Moh Moh Ke Dhaage" capture the emotional journey of the characters perfectly. The film's setting in the 1990s is beautifully recreated through its costumes, music, and cultural references, making it a nostalgic trip for many viewers.
